The present invention relates to the field of domestic and commercial mobile electric floor treatment machines. The invention relates in particular to providing a mode of operation in an appliance, such as a vacuum cleaner, which reduces energy consumption. Thus there is disclosed a mobile floor treatment machine which relies upon electric motor power for its functioning, the appliance including electric power control means capable of permitting the appliance to operate in either a high power mode or a low power mode, the control means being provided with power switching means for controlling whether the high or low power modes is adopted, the switching means being configured so that when the appliance is activated by means of an on/off switch the machine operates by default in the low power mode and wherein a user-operable override switch is provided, actuation of which causes the power control means to adopt the high power mode, and wherein further actuation of the override switch causes the machine to revert to the low power mode, the power switching means being further configured so that in the event of the machine being turned-off when operating in the high power mode, the power control means defaults so as to operate in the low power mode when re-activated. The machine is preferably a vacuum cleaner for cleaning floor surfaces such as carpets. The machine always defaults to low power mode, so as to promote energy saving.
